Discover How Water Soluble PVA Filament is Revolutionizing Additive Manufacturing with Eco-Friendly, High-Precision Support Solutions
The unique properties of polyvinyl alcohol-based filaments have positioned them as indispensable materials within modern additive manufacturing. By leveraging water solubility, manufacturers can produce intricate geometries that were once prohibitively complex, eliminating the need for manual support removal and dramatically improving post-processing efficiency. As the demand for precision prototyping intensifies across industries, water soluble PVA filament has emerged as the go-to support material due to its seamless integration with multi-material 3D printing workflows.
Beyond its technical advantages, the filament’s eco-friendly profile resonates with organizations committed to sustainable production practices. The ability to dissolve support structures in water without generating chemical byproducts reduces waste streams and aligns with corporate responsibility goals. In particular, medical and dental manufacturers have embraced PVA’s capabilities to fabricate patient-specific surgical guides and dental models, reducing turnaround times and ensuring superior surface integrity in complex shapes.
Moreover, as industries such as automotive and aerospace shift toward lightweight component testing and rapid functional prototyping, the demand for reliable support solutions has grown substantially. Traditional support materials introduce labor-intensive steps that undermine the speed and cost benefits of additive manufacturing. By contrast, PVA filaments offer a clean, automated alternative that preserves part accuracy and drastically reduces the risk of damage during support removal. This introduction establishes PVA’s central role in revolutionizing how advanced prototypes and end-use parts are produced.
Uncover The Transformative Technological And Sustainable Shifts Redefining Water Soluble PVA Filament Usage Across Multiple Industries
Over the past few years, water soluble PVA filament has undergone significant evolution driven by breakthroughs in multi-material 3D printing. Where once support structures were a limiting factor in design complexity, modern PVA formulations now dissolve rapidly without leaving residues, enabling the creation of intricate, interlocking assemblies that would otherwise demand extensive manual labor. This shift has unlocked new design paradigms, particularly in industries where internal channels and complex undercuts are critical to performance, such as fluidic devices and lightweight mechanical components.
Simultaneously, sustainability has ascended from a niche concern to a core strategic imperative. The development of biodegradable PVA blends and formulations optimized for lower environmental impact exemplifies this transition. Manufacturers are increasingly integrating PVA filaments into circular economy initiatives, capturing and reprocessing dissolved polymer solutions to minimize resource consumption. These approaches not only reduce waste but also demonstrate how advanced material science can meet both technical and environmental benchmarks, signaling a broader transformation in material selection for additive manufacturing.
In parallel, the integration of PVA filaments into automated high-throughput printing systems has redefined operational efficiency. Coupling precision water baths with digital monitoring ensures consistent support removal across large batches, reducing bottlenecks in post-processing. This integration underscores how PVA’s inherent solubility dovetails with Industry 4.0 aspirations, delivering data-driven workflows that enhance throughput while maintaining stringent quality standards. Collectively, these technological and environmental shifts are charting a new course for PVA filament, positioning it as a cornerstone of the future additive manufacturing ecosystem.
Evaluate The Cumulative Impact Of The 2025 United States Tariffs On Water Soluble PVA Filament Import Costs And Supply Chains
The 2025 revision of the United States Harmonized Tariff Schedule has introduced critical considerations for PVA filament importers and manufacturers. Under HTS code 3905.30.00.00, polyvinyl alcohol products now incur a general duty rate of 3.2 percent, while imports originating from China face an ad valorem surcharge of 25 percent on top of the base rate, effectively raising the applied duty to 28.2 percent. Products sourced from Free Trade Agreement partners enjoy duty-free treatment, providing a strategic incentive for companies to diversify sourcing beyond high-tariff regions.
These tariff dynamics have cumulative impacts on the PVA filament supply chain. Elevated import costs from concentrated suppliers in China have prompted stakeholders to explore alternative suppliers in ASEAN and Latin America, where favorable trade agreements can reduce landed costs. Simultaneously, domestic filament compounding facilities are expanding capacity to capitalize on reshoring trends and mitigate tariff exposures. Organizations that proactively adjust procurement strategies-shifting volume to low-duty origins or investing in localized production-are better positioned to stabilize pricing and secure uninterrupted filament supplies. As global trade policies continue to evolve, understanding and adapting to these tariff structures will remain a vital component of resilient additive manufacturing operations.

Type-based segmentation underscores the critical influence of polymer chemistry on performance. Filaments categorized by degree of hydrolysis distinguish fully hydrolyzed grades-valued for their mechanical robustness but requiring elevated temperatures for dissolution-from partially hydrolyzed variants that dissolve readily at ambient conditions. Molecular weight classifications further delineate the balance between strength and solubility; high molecular weight filaments confer superior tensile properties yet necessitate longer solvent exposure, whereas low molecular weight grades deliver rapid dissolution at the expense of reduced mechanical stability. These chemical dimensions guide material selection across applications, ensuring design requirements align with functional demands.

Discover Key Company Strategies And Innovations Steering The Highly Competitive Water Soluble PVA Filament Market Towards Sustainable Excellence
Major players in the PVA filament space are intensifying efforts to differentiate through material innovation and expanded production capabilities. Shenzhen-based eSUN has introduced a next-generation water soluble support material-eSoluble-that accelerates dissolution rates by leveraging novel polymer blends, doubling the speed of conventional PVA and enhancing moisture stability during printing operations. By optimizing the polymer’s crystallinity and hydrophilic balance, eSUN has broadened compatibility with a wider range of base materials, from PLA derivatives to nylon composites.
In North America, MatterHackers has cemented its reputation by offering premium Pro Series PVA filaments engineered for dimensional tolerance and thermal resilience. These materials dissolve cleanly in conventional water baths and adhere robustly to primary build materials, minimizing warpage during high-detail prototyping. The company’s emphasis on quality control and ancillary drying solutions has driven high repeat purchase rates among professional users.
Polymaker, headquartered in Shanghai, has advanced its PolyDissolve line with industrial-grade specifications tailored to high-temperature printing environments. By fine-tuning molecular weight distributions, Polymaker achieves an optimal balance between mechanical performance and dissolution kinetics, meeting the stringent demands of aerospace and automotive functional testing applications. Their global distribution network ensures rapid delivery to key manufacturing hubs.
Finally, Novamaker has disrupted entry-level segments by providing competitively priced PVA spools with consistent dimensional accuracy. Their product’s high customer satisfaction metrics on major e-commerce platforms reflect robust printability and predictable dissolution timelines, making Novamaker a go-to supplier for educational institutions and small-scale innovators. Collectively, these company strategies illuminate how differentiated material science, supply chain agility, and targeted distribution approaches define success in the competitive PVA filament market.
